Beyond the software itself, optimal CRM success requires choosing the right technology partner. Here are crucial vendor selection criteria healthcare organizations should consider:

Healthcare Domain Expertise

Seeking out vendors with proven healthcare-specific solutions and case studies ensures selecting a platform purpose-built for common needs like HIPAA compliance, EHR integrations, and appointment management.

Data Security and Regulatory Compliance

As PHI requires stringent safeguards, evaluating a CRM‘s encryption, access controls, regulatory auditing and security certifications is imperative before adoption.

Implementation and Ongoing Support Services

The specialized needs of healthcare may require custom workflows and staff training, so turnkey implementation guidance and responsive vendor supportsmoothen rollout.

Scalability and Reliability

Medical operations run 24/7 and patient volumes fluctuate, so the CRM must deliver high availability and easily scale capacity without disruption.

Interoperability and EHR Integration

APIs and out-of-the-box interfaces with major EHR/EMR systems like Epic or Cernerenable seamless data sharing between the CRM and patient health records.

Healthcare Experience of the Vendor

Vendors having proven success guiding healthcare clients through digital transformation initiatives have invaluable first-hand experience to ensure your CRM success.

With the right partner, healthcare CRMs can transform productivity and service delivery. Let‘s examine some of the key capabilities driving these improvements across medical organizations:

Appointment Scheduling and Resource Optimization

Intuitive calendar systems optimize scheduling of doctors, staff, and facility usage to maximize access and convenience for patients. Some advanced solutions even allow patients to self-schedule appointments online.

Omnichannel Patient Communication

Today‘s consumers expect seamless messaging across their preferred channels like SMS, email, web chat etc. CRM integrated communication functionality helps health providers easily connect with patients how they want.

Referral and Revenue Cycle Management

Robust CRMs track both internal referrals across departments and external referrals from other practitioners to optimize new patient acquisition and attribuate revenue to sources.

Patient Profile and History Consolidation

Unified CRM profiles with clinical, demographic and engagement data on each patient enable personalized experiences and proactive care based on medical history.

Service Workflow Automation

Streamlining repetitive administrative tasks with CRM automated workflows reduces overhead for medical staffers and allows reallocating time to higher-value activities.

Analytics and Reporting

Embedded CRM analytics empower managers to track KPIs like patient volume trends, referral patterns, revenue cycle metrics, appointment utilization rates and more to inform strategy.
